HIP 112926
HIP 112926 is a F-type (Yellow-White) star located in the constellation Aquarius.
Located approximately 366.1 light-years from Earth, HIP 112926 resides within the broader disk of our Milky Way galaxy.
HIP 112926 is classified as a spectral class F star (F-type (Yellow-White)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.
HIP 112926 has an apparent magnitude of +8.83,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its white h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+0.497.
